Subject: Handover — Flagmast Rollout Framework

Hi Dorit,

Before the weekly sync, here's where Flagmast stands. The rollout tables migrated cleanly to the new cluster, and the percentage-bucket logic now reads from the canonical flags schema rather than the legacy cache. Two stale flags remain archived pending product sign-off. For verification, please run the consistency checks against the flags database directly, using the connection string below.

replica DSN, kajep-yahag: mssql://praok_svc:iF@db-8d68.plorvaio.local:5432/eliion

### Handover: Grelby ORM refactor

Hey team — passing the ORM refactor baton before I head off to the Dunmore office. Short version: the legacy Grelby data layer is half-migrated to the new Quartzline mappers. Reads go through the new path; writes still hit the old one, so don't panic if you see dual query logs. The feature flag flips per-tenant. If a customer reports weird stale records, check the flag first. For local repro, spin up the service with the settings listed below.

deployment values, tagug-tagaf:
[zorix]
team = druix
access_code = ac_42e3e2
host = zorix.qirvancorp.test
port = 6379
owner = beldor.gordor
peer = kelath.zemvarcorp.test

Ticket — Brightline platform: trace context dropped between services. Support is seeing requests that start in the Orderflow service but vanish from traces once they hit the Ledgerette billing service, making escalations hard to triage. Root cause appears to be the billing gateway stripping propagation headers after last week's proxy upgrade. Workaround: correlate by order reference and timestamp until the patched gateway ships. Engineering has a candidate fix in staging now. The staging build token is included below.

trace token, fafog-kageg: htk4_98e6

## Environments

The Nightglean backfill scheduler runs in three environments: dev, staging, and prod. Dev uses a five-minute tick for fast iteration; staging mirrors prod's nightly window but targets a snapshot of last week's data. Job concurrency and retry budgets differ per environment, which has caused confusion in past reviews. The full set of per-environment values is captured below.

service settings:
[casax]
port = 6379
team = rusir
host = casax.zemvarhq.corp
region = outer-4
access_code = ac_9808ce
timeout_ms = 1500